UMG, BandLab Pact On Ethical Use Of A.I.

• Universal Music Group (UMG) and BandLab Technologies, the parent company of the world’s largest social music creation platform, BandLab, announced plans for an expansive, industry-first strategic relationship concentrated on artificial intelligence (A.I.). The alliance will advance the companies’ shared commitment to ethical use of A.I. and the protection of artist and songwriter rights. Together, the companies will also pioneer market-led solutions with pro-creator standards to ensure new technologies serve the creator community effectively and ethically.
